Crunchy Critters Edible Insects Mixed Critters pack delivers a high-protein, nutrient-dense snack sourced sustainably from the UK and Denmark. Microwave-dried for a crispy nutty flavor, this 20g pack offers versatile preparation options and supports a healthy lifestyle with 57.4g protein, 5.5g fiber, and 497 kcal per 100g.

Okay as an attraction; overpriced as food
They taste all right, but they lack any seasoning and the texture is uniform throughout (except the locust wings... those are weird). None of the random people who tried them hated them, but no one thought they tasted great.The more I ate, the more I liked them, but the 20g ran out after a day of nibbling. I'd buy again (especially the mealworms) if I could find cheaper ones meant for humans. The prices of these packs (£8.50) are inflated beyond their value as food, no matter the category.

Hmmm ... intriguing ...
Interesting product - never consciously chosen to eat insects before. Guessing maybe a little reminiscent of prawn or other multi limbed, armoured, crunchy arthropod type things. What you get is dry, savoury, rice papery snack. Nothing to object to. Nothing to love. Some food writers suggest we need to turn to insects to deliver the protein mass the world demands. Joy! Presumably the cultures of the world that do make use of our multi limbed friends in their diet have better ways of cooking them. Three stars for interest value.
